Easy Marinated Sirloin Steak

20 min4 servings

The recipe for the marinade comes from my brother, and we rarely grill without it. It's also great on chicken and pork. —Terrie Sowders, Carthage, Indiana

Ingredients
3/4 cup apple juice
3/4 cup soy sauce
1/4 cup olive oil
1 tablespoon each minced fresh oregano, rosemary and thyme
3 garlic cloves, minced
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1 beef top sirloin steak (1-1/2 pounds)
Instructions
1 In a shallow dish, combine the apple juice, soy sauce, oil and seasonings. Add the beef and turn to coat. Cover; refrigerate for at least 1 hour.
2 Drain and discard marinade. Grill steak, covered, over medium heat for 8-10 minutes on each side or until meat reaches desired doneness (for medium-rare, a thermometer should read 135°; medium, 140°; medium-well, 145°). To serve, thinly slice against the grain.
